BusinessWhat FIS does

Fidelity National Information Services (FIS) is a financial technology company providing software, services, and outsourcing for banking, payments, capital markets, and wealth management. Revenue lines include technology solutions and professional services for financial institutions globally.

How does GovGreed track FIS political activity?
GovGreed integrates STOCK Act congressional trade disclosures, FEC contributions, OGE executive-branch disclosures, USASpending federal contracts, Senate LDA lobbying filings, and SEC Form 4 corporate insider trades into a single queryable graph. FIS data is updated daily from these official federal sources.
